40 Locations Join Loyalty Marketing Program, More to Follow as Chain Expands Nationally

CHICAGO–(BUSINESS WIRE)–Rewards Network, a leading provider of marketing services and loyalty programs to restaurants, has just added 40 Garlic Jim’s Famous Gourmet Pizza® locations to its coast-to-coast dining program. More will be added to the program as the fast-growing chain expands across the country.

Named one of “four chains to watch” by Pizza Marketplace, Garlic Jim’s is breaking the mold by combining a high-end, gourmet product with high-speed, carryout/delivery service. It’s a concept that has taken off, catapulting the chain from two to 40 stores since 2004. Garlic Jim’s plans to double in size during 2007.

With headquarters in Everett, Washington, and many locations on the West Coast, several members of the Garlic Jim’s management team are Alaska Airlines Mileage Plan members. In fact, that’s what brought Rewards Network to their attention. Dwayne Northrop, Founder and Chief Executive Officer of Garlic Jim’s, explained, “Lex Nepomuceno, our chief marketing officer, is a mileage maniac. He earns thousands of miles every year by dining at participating restaurants. If a program can elicit that kind of customer loyalty, we want to be part of it.”

Rewards Network President and CEO Ron Blake views Garlic Jim’s as a great addition to the thousands of restaurants already participating across North America. “Garlic Jim’s is a leader in gourmet pizza delivery. Their product targets the discerning diner who wants quality plus convenience. Our members fit that profile, so this alliance is a win-win for everyone.”

Northrop expressed equal enthusiasm. “As we expand, we want to focus on building our brand awareness and customer base. Through Rewards Network, we’ll be able to reward customers with Alaska Airlines Mileage Plan miles, Upromise college savings rewards, eScrip nonprofit contributions and cash back. It’s a great way for us to keep our chain in growth mode with a steady stream of loyal, repeat diners.”

Northrop is also relying on those loyal diners to help Garlic Jim’s maintain quality control. Rewards Network’s reporting includes member ratings and feedback. “What distinguishes us from other fast-delivery pizza chains is the gourmet quality of our product. Rewards Network’s customer feedback will go a long way toward helping us monitor our franchise operations to maintain the product and service standards on which we’re building the Garlic Jim’s brand.”

About Garlic Jim’s

Garlic Jim’s Famous Gourmet Pizza is the first pizza franchise to focus on quick-delivery pizza made fresh with gourmet toppings. With it’s in-store system and intensive team training, Garlic Jim’s is able to make pizza in 25 minutes or less “from order to out the door,” thus pioneering the “Gourmet, Right Away” concept. The term ‘gourmet’’s use of the finest ingredients: fresh packed sauces, fresh 100% whole-milk mozzarella, and fresh dough made daily. Garlic Jim’s offers customers two crust choices: hand-thrown thick crust, made with parmesan cheese and buttermilk, or garlic thin. There are also four cheese options, seven sauces, and a variety of meats, fresh vegetables, and other gourmet toppings. In addition to current locations in Oregon, Arizona, California, Pennsylvania and Washington, Garlic Jim’s has stores under development in New Jersey, Colorado, Florida, Tennessee and Texas. About Rewards Network

Rewards Network (AMEX:IRN), head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is a leading provider of marketing services and loyalty programs to the restaurant industry. Thousands of participating restaurants and other merchants across North America benefit from the Company’s extensive email, internet and print marketing efforts; member ratings/feedback and other business intelligence; customer loyalty programs; and access to capital. In conjunction with leading airline frequent flyer programs, club memberships, and other affinity organizations, Rewards Network provides over three million members with incentives to dine at participating restaurants, including airline miles, college savings rewards, loyalty/reward program points, and Cashback RewardsSM savings.
